Searched refs:frame_buffer (Results 1 - 25 of 95) sorted by last modified time

1234

/haiku/src/system/boot/platform/bios_ia32/
H A Dvideo.cpp614 if (gKernelArgs.frame_buffer.depth != 8)
821 switch (gKernelArgs.frame_buffer.depth) {
845 addr_t lastBase = gKernelArgs.frame_buffer.physical_buffer.start;
846 size_t lastSize = gKernelArgs.frame_buffer.physical_buffer.size;
866 gKernelArgs.frame_buffer.width = modeInfo.width;
867 gKernelArgs.frame_buffer.height = modeInfo.height;
868 gKernelArgs.frame_buffer.bytes_per_row = modeInfo.bytes_per_row;
869 gKernelArgs.frame_buffer.depth = modeInfo.bits_per_pixel;
870 gKernelArgs.frame_buffer.physical_buffer.size
872 * (phys_size_t)gKernelArgs.frame_buffer
[all...]
/haiku/src/add-ons/kernel/drivers/graphics/intel_extreme/
H A Dintel_extreme.cpp750 info.shared_info->frame_buffer = 0;
/haiku/headers/private/graphics/intel_extreme/
H A Dintel_extreme.h439 addr_t frame_buffer; member in struct:intel_shared_info
/haiku/src/add-ons/kernel/drivers/graphics/virtio/
H A Dvirtio_gpu.cpp455 sharedInfo.frame_buffer = (uint8*)info->framebuffer;
622 sharedInfo.frame_buffer = (uint8*)info->framebuffer;
/haiku/src/add-ons/accelerants/virtio/
H A Dmode.cpp156 config->frame_buffer = gInfo->shared_info->frame_buffer;
158 config->frame_buffer));
161 TRACE(("virtio_gpu_get_frame_buffer_config() %p\n", config->frame_buffer));
/haiku/headers/private/graphics/virtio/
H A Dvirtio_info.h22 uint8* frame_buffer; member in struct:virtio_gpu_shared_info
/haiku/src/servers/app/drawing/interface/local/
H A DAccelerantHWInterface.cpp687 _kern_frame_buffer_update((addr_t)fFrameBufferConfig.frame_buffer,
/haiku/src/system/boot/platform/efi/
H A Dvideo.cpp170 gKernelArgs.frame_buffer.enabled = false;
229 gKernelArgs.frame_buffer.enabled = false;
233 gKernelArgs.frame_buffer.enabled = true;
254 if (sGraphicsOutput == NULL || !gKernelArgs.frame_buffer.enabled)
261 gKernelArgs.frame_buffer.physical_buffer.start =
263 gKernelArgs.frame_buffer.physical_buffer.size =
265 gKernelArgs.frame_buffer.width =
267 gKernelArgs.frame_buffer.height =
269 gKernelArgs.frame_buffer.depth =
271 gKernelArgs.frame_buffer
[all...]
/haiku/src/add-ons/kernel/drivers/graphics/framebuffer/
H A Dframebuffer.cpp101 addr_t frameBuffer = info.frame_buffer;
133 info.frame_buffer = frameBuffer;
148 sharedInfo.frame_buffer = (uint8*)frameBuffer;
/haiku/src/add-ons/accelerants/framebuffer/
H A Dmode.cpp137 config->frame_buffer = gInfo->shared_info->frame_buffer;
/haiku/src/servers/app/drawing/interface/virtual/
H A DDWindowHWInterface.cpp781 config.frame_buffer = fFrontBuffer->Bits();
H A DViewHWInterface.cpp623 config.frame_buffer = fFrontBuffer->Bits();
H A DDWindowBuffer.cpp107 fBits = (uint8*)config->frame_buffer;
/haiku/src/add-ons/kernel/drivers/graphics/nvidia/
H A Ddriver.c539 int frame_buffer = 1; local
673 physicalAddress = di->pcii.u.h0.base_registers_pci[frame_buffer];
674 if ((di->pcii.u.h0.base_register_flags[frame_buffer] & PCI_address_type)
678 |= (uint64)di->pcii.u.h0.base_registers_pci[frame_buffer + 1] << 32;
687 di->pcii.u.h0.base_register_sizes[frame_buffer],
697 di->pcii.u.h0.base_register_sizes[frame_buffer],
716 si->ps.memory_size = di->pcii.u.h0.base_register_sizes[frame_buffer];
/haiku/src/add-ons/accelerants/nvidia/engine/
H A Dnv_general.c1391 /* make sure we don't corrupt the hardware cursor by using fbc.frame_buffer. */
1392 if (si->fbc.frame_buffer == NULL)
1401 ((uint32 *)si->fbc.frame_buffer)[offset] = value;
1409 if (((uint32 *)si->fbc.frame_buffer)[offset] != value) result = B_ERROR;
/haiku/src/add-ons/kernel/drivers/graphics/vesa/
H A Dvesa.cpp300 addr_t frameBuffer = info.frame_buffer;
331 info.frame_buffer = frameBuffer;
346 sharedInfo.frame_buffer = (uint8*)frameBuffer;
H A Dvesa_private.h36 addr_t frame_buffer; member in struct:vesa_info
/haiku/src/add-ons/kernel/drivers/graphics/radeon_hd/
H A Dradeon_hd.cpp796 (void**)&info.shared_info->frame_buffer);
804 (addr_t)info.shared_info->frame_buffer);
/haiku/headers/private/graphics/radeon_hd/
H A Dradeon_hd.h232 uint8* frame_buffer; // virtual memory mapped FB member in struct:radeon_shared_info
/haiku/src/add-ons/accelerants/vesa/
H A Dhooks.cpp71 buffer->buffer = gInfo->shared_info->frame_buffer;
H A Dmode.cpp281 config->frame_buffer = gInfo->shared_info->frame_buffer;
/haiku/src/system/kernel/debug/
H A Dframe_buffer_console.cpp51 addr_t frame_buffer; member in struct:console_info
150 uint8* base = (uint8*)(sConsole.frame_buffer
179 uint8* base = (uint8*)(sConsole.frame_buffer
222 uint8* base = (uint8*)(sConsole.frame_buffer + y * sConsole.bytes_per_row);
323 memmove((void*)(sConsole.frame_buffer + (desty + y)
325 (void*)(sConsole.frame_buffer + (srcy + y) * sConsole.bytes_per_row
342 memset((void*)sConsole.frame_buffer,
347 memset((void*)sConsole.frame_buffer, 0xff,
353 uint8* base = (uint8*)sConsole.frame_buffer;
410 return sConsole.frame_buffer !
[all...]
/haiku/src/add-ons/accelerants/intel_extreme/
H A Dmode.cpp370 intel_free_memory(sharedInfo.frame_buffer);
379 sharedInfo.frame_buffer = base;
391 sharedInfo.frame_buffer = base;
734 config->frame_buffer = gInfo->shared_info->graphics_memory + offset;
/haiku/headers/private/graphics/vesa/
H A Dvesa_info.h41 uint8* frame_buffer; member in struct:vesa_shared_info
/haiku/src/add-ons/accelerants/radeon_hd/
H A Dmode.cpp283 config->frame_buffer = gInfo->shared_info->frame_buffer;
288 TRACE(" config->frame_buffer: %#" B_PRIxADDR "\n",
289 (phys_addr_t)config->frame_buffer);

Completed in 168 milliseconds

1234